Qualys, Inc. (NASDAQ:QLYS) Receives Consensus Rating of "Reduce" from Brokerages

Qualys logo with Computer and Technology background

Shares of Qualys, Inc. (NASDAQ:QLYS - Get Free Report) have been given an average rating of "Reduce" by the seventeen brokerages that are presently covering the stock, Marketbeat Ratings reports.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a sell recommendation, twelve have given a hold recommendation and two have assigned a buy recommendation to the company. The average twelve-month price target among brokerages that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$137.50.

A number of equities research analysts have recently commented on QLYS shares. Royal Bank Of Canada increased their target price on Qualys from $131.00 to $140.00 and gave the stock a "sector perform" rating in a research note on Wednesday, May 7th. Canaccord Genuity Group cut their price objective on shares of Qualys from $163.00 to $158.00 and set a "buy" rating on the stock in a research report on Wednesday, May 7th. Wall Street Zen lowered shares of Qualys from a "bu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a research note on Saturday, June 14th. Morgan Stanley decreased their target price on shares of Qualys from $120.00 to $90.00 and set an "underweight" rating for the company in a report on Wednesday, April 16th. Finally, JPMorgan Chase & Co. cut their price target on shares of Qualys from $122.00 to $117.00 and set an "underweight" rating on the stock in a report on Monday, April 28th.

Qualys Stock Down 2.1%

NASDAQ QLYS opened at $137.20 on Thursday. The firm has a market capitalization of $4.98 billion, a PE ratio of 28.06 and a beta of 0.61. The stock's 50 day moving average is $132.41 and its 200 day moving average is $135.42. Qualys has a twelve month low of $112.61 and a twelve month high of $170.00.

Qualys (NASDAQ:QLYS -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, May 6th. The software maker reported $1.67 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$1.46 by $0.21. The firm had revenue of $159.90 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$157.05 million. Qualys had a net margin of 29.19% and a return on equity of 38.05%. The company's quarterly revenue was up 9.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$1.45 EPS. On average, research analysts anticipate that Qualys will post 3.85 earnings per share for the current year.

Insider Activity at Qualys

In other Qualys news, CEO Sumedh S. Thakar sold 8,500 shares of the company's stock in a transaction that occurred on Thursday, May 29th. The shares were sold at an average price of $136.30, for a total transaction of $1,158,550.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ief executive officer now directly owns 237,962 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$32,434,220.60. This represents a 3.45%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website. Also, CFO Joo Mi Kim sold 845 shares of Qualys stock in a transaction on Thursday, June 5th. The stock was sold at an average price of $139.96, for a total transaction of $118,266.20. Following the transaction, the chief financial officer now owns 100,075 shares in the company, valued at $14,006,497. This represents a 0.84% dec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Over the last 90 days, insiders sold 33,105 shares of company stock worth $4,390,137. 0.88% of the stock is owned by insiders.

Qualys Company Profile

Qualys,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ides cloud-based platform delivering information technology (IT), security, and compliance solutions in the United States and internationally. It offers Qualys Cloud Apps, which include Cybersecurity Asset Management and External Attack Surface Management; Vulnerability Management, Detection and Response; Web Application Scanning; Patch Management; Custom Assessment and Remediation; Multi-Vector Endpoint Detection and Response; Context Extended Detection and Response; Policy Compliance; File Integrity Monitoring; and Qualys TotalCloud, as well as Cloud Workload Protection, Cloud Detection and Response, Cloud Security Posture Management, Infrastructure as Code, and Container Security.
